LaTHROP v. BELL FEDERAL SAVINGS & LOAN

No. 60252.

42 Ill. App.3d 183 (1976)

355 N.E.2d 667

ERNEST LaTHROP et al., Plaintiffs-Appellants, v. BELL FEDERAL SAVINGS AND LOAN ASSOCIATION, Defendant-Appellee.

Appellate Court of Illinois — First District (3rd Division).

Modified upon denial of rehearing October 7, 1976.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Edward Atlas and Harold A. Harris, both of Maremont, Lewin & Maremont, of Chicago, for appellants.

Henry F. Vallely and James M. Staulcup, Jr., both of Cummings & Wyman, of Chicago, for appellee.


Judgment affirmed.

Mr. JUSTICE McGLOON delivered the opinion of the court:

In this case, we are asked to consider the question of whether individuals representing a class of mortgagors are entitled to maintain an action against their mortgagee for interest earned by the mortgagee on the mortgagors' advance payments to the mortgagee for taxes, assessments, and insurance.
